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
186 833873 93265620797 953365 037617038
507676447 0838864 226964310
507676447 0838864 226964310
0572634334 601 425325
All about undefined
Interested in learning more?
507676447 0838864 226964310
0572634334 601 425325
See more
796533087 96816
951358908 505690901 13825719325
See more
346877354 82753947 57958625
56377094484 43651319 9640
See more